Types of Modular Wall Panels
Precast Concrete Panels
Description
Precast concrete panels are made in factories for quick building. They are shaped using molds, ensuring they are the right size and strong. These panels are often used in homes and offices because they last long and can be used in many ways. They can make walls stronger or look more attractive.
Key Advantages
Speed and Efficiency: Precast panels save time during construction. Since they are made elsewhere, bad weather or site issues won’t slow things down.
Quality and Consistency: These panels are made to strict rules, so they are always reliable.
Flexibility: Precast panels can be designed to match special styles, making them great for unique projects.
Sustainability: They create less waste and help save energy, cutting costs over time.

Key Disadvantages
Moving and setting up precast panels may need special tools. They can also cost more at first than other options.
Structural Insulated Panels (SIPs)
Description
Structural Insulated Panels (SIPs) are lightweight wall parts with foam inside. They are strong and keep heat in, making them great for saving energy. SIPs are used in walls, roofs, and floors to make buildings warmer or cooler.
Key Advantages
Energy Efficiency: SIPs are great at keeping heat in or out, saving money on energy.
Compliance with Standards: SIPs follow strict rules to ensure they are safe and high-quality.
Durability: These panels can handle tough weather and even earthquakes, making them dependable.

Key Disadvantages
SIPs can cost more than regular materials. They also need careful handling to avoid breaking them during setup.
Metal Wall Panels
Description
Metal wall panels are strong, light, and useful for many buildings. They are often used in offices and factories because they last long and look modern. Insulated Metal Panels (IMPs) combine insulation and support, making them both useful and cost-saving.
Key Advantages
Durability: Metal panels, especially steel ones, last a long time and resist damage from weather.
Ease of Installation: IMPs make building easier by combining several wall parts into one. This saves time and reduces waste.
Sustainability: Steel can be recycled, making metal panels a green choice for building.

Key Disadvantages
Metal panels can get dents or scratches. In very hot or cold places, extra insulation might be needed to save energy.
Wood-Based Panels
Description
Wood-based panels are a flexible and eco-friendly choice for building. They are made from engineered wood like plywood, OSB, or MDF. These panels are light and easy to customize, making them useful in modular homes. They can be used for structure or decoration, offering both strength and style.
These panels are common in modular construction systems. They are stable and simple to work with, making them great for modular projects. Plus, they support sustainability by using renewable materials and cutting down on waste.
Key Advantages
Sustainability: Using wood-based panels creates less waste. A study from Colorado State University found modular methods leave less than five percent scrap, keeping wood out of landfills.
Efficiency: These panels speed up building, reducing construction time by 30% to 50%. This makes them perfect for prefabricated projects.
Material Versatility: Wood-based panels work for many uses, like walls or decorations. Their flexibility allows creative designs in modular homes.
Cost-Effectiveness: Better material use and less waste lower building costs overall.
Key Disadvantages
Wood-based panels may not last in wet areas. Water can weaken them over time. Also, they don’t resist fire as well as magnesium wall panels.
Glass Reinforced Panels (GRPs)
Description
Glass Reinforced Panels (GRPs) are strong but light panels made with glass fibers and resin. They are popular in modular construction for their strength and light weight. GRPs are often used in factories and offices where tough materials are needed.
GRPs are also great for smooth surfaces, making them ideal for clean spaces like hospitals. They can also be used for decoration, giving a modern look.
Key Advantages
Durability: GRPs resist rust, water, and chemicals, lasting a long time.
Lightweight: They are strong but light, saving on transport and setup costs.
Design Flexibility: GRPs can be shaped into different forms for creative designs.
Key Disadvantages
GRPs cost more than regular materials. Also, their synthetic resins may not meet all eco-friendly goals.
Magnesium Wall Panels

Description
Magnesium wall panels are a new and smart option for building. Made from magnesium oxide, they are light and resist fire very well. These panels are used in homes and offices, especially in modular buildings.
Magnesium panels are stable and easy to install, making them practical for modular systems. They resist fire, water, and mold, ensuring they last a long time.
Key Advantages
Fire Resistance: Magnesium panels are great for fire safety, ideal for secure projects.
Ease of Installation: Their light weight makes them easy to handle and lowers labor costs.
Market Growth: The U.S. market for magnesium panels is growing fast, with thin panels leading by 2025. This shows their rising demand in modular construction.
Sustainability: These panels are eco-friendly, durable, and recyclable.
Key Disadvantages
Magnesium panels cost more upfront than other materials. However, their long-term benefits often make up for the higher price.
Antibacterial Modular Wall Panels
Description
Antibacterial wall panels help keep spaces clean and safe. They use special materials like silver nanoparticles to stop bacteria from growing. These panels are often found in hospitals, labs, and food factories. They are also useful in modular homes where cleanliness is very important.
These panels not only fight germs but also add strength to buildings. They are light and strong, fitting easily into modular homes and systems. By combining health benefits with practical use, they meet modern building needs.
Research shows silver nanoparticles can cut bacteria by huge amounts. For example, they reduce E. coli and Staphylococcus aureus by 5–7 levels and Staphylococcus epidermidis biofilms by 5 levels in 24 hours.
Key Advantages
Better Hygiene: These panels kill bacteria, keeping spaces cleaner.
Strong and Long-Lasting: They are tough and work well in many places.
Useful Everywhere: Great for homes, offices, and other modular buildings.
Easy to Clean: Smooth surfaces make wiping them down simple.
Key Disadvantages
Antibacterial panels cost more than regular ones. But their long-term benefits make them worth it.
Demountable Wall Panels
Description
Demountable wall panels are easy to move and reuse. They are made for quick setup and removal, perfect for places that change often. You’ll see them in offices, showrooms, and modular homes. Their design fits well into prefabricated buildings, saving time and money.
These panels are sturdy but flexible, making them great for modern projects. They are light, easy to transport, and quick to install, cutting down on costs and time.
Key Advantages
Fast Setup: These panels go up in just a few hours.
Reusable: You can use them again, saving money and reducing waste.
Flexible Design: Ideal for spaces that need frequent changes, like offices.
Affordable: Lower labor and material costs make them budget-friendly.

Durability
Durability means panels can handle tough weather and stay strong. SIPs are very durable. They can handle extreme heat, strong winds, and heavy snow. Their tight design keeps pests out, and fire treatments make them safer. Studies show SIPs can last over 60 years with little wear.
